ES6 暴露模組及匯入注意事項

2022-09-22 03:36:12 字數 720 閱讀 4847

export與export default均可用於匯出常量、函式、檔案、模組等

在乙個檔案或模組中,export、import可以有多個,export default僅有乙個

如果乙個檔案裡export了很多函式(常量,變數), 如果你想在目標一次性全部匯入模組的所有函式(常量,變數)就可以使用   import * as ***代表全部

通過export方式匯出,在匯入時要加(因為export方式需要一一對應,本質上使用了解構),而export default則不需要

export能直接匯出變數表示式,export default不行。

export引數指定單個(多個)的命名匯出,import from "***",一一對應的引入foo,bar

export引數指定多個的命名匯出,而import * as name語法匯入所有匯出介面,即匯入模組整體。

如何理解import * as obj from "***"會將"***"中所有export匯出的內容組合成乙個模組(物件obj)返回。若模組中包含乙個乙個介面getlist(),則呼叫時需寫obj.getlist()

如何理解  import from '***',這裡是將 a 引入的同時重新命名為obj。

如何理解  import "***"  僅僅執行***裡的**,而不輸入任何值(還不了解具體使用場景為什麼要這麼寫)

es6模組暴露

es6模組匯入和匯出 匯出 export,export default 可以匯出變數,函式,物件,檔案,模組 匯入 import function add 1 export add 匯入 import from add.js 匯入時要加,呼叫 add 可以匯出多個,加 export export a...

es6模組匯入匯出

如何在 webpack 構建的專案中,使用 vue 進行開發 複習 在普通網頁中如何使用vue 1.使用 script 標籤 引入 vue 的包 3.通過 new vue 得到乙個 vm 的例項 在webpack 中嘗試使用 vue 注意 在 webpack 中,使用 import vue from...

ES6箭頭函式常見考點與注意事項

2.注意事項 與普通函式的區別 3.箭頭函式獲取引數 4.箭頭函式中this的指向 es6標準入門第三版 基本使用 varf console.log hello f 輸出 hello如果箭頭函式不需要引數或需要多個引數,就使用圓括號代表引數部分 沒有引數,必不可少 console.log hello...